реклама на сайте
подробности

 
 
3 страниц V  < 1 2 3  
Reply to this topicStart new topic
> Подключение USB флешки к сомодельному прибору
TBI
сообщение Jan 14 2008, 13:37
Сообщение #31


Частый гость
**

Группа: Свой
Сообщений: 170
Регистрация: 11-05-07
Пользователь №: 27 656



Цитата(rv3dll(lex) @ Jan 14 2008, 16:33) *
а через год не будет карточек под фат 16
а именно останутся 4 8 16 и 32 гб


Тогда будет FAT32
Go to the top of the page
 
+Quote Post
Николай Z
сообщение Jan 14 2008, 13:45
Сообщение #32


Местный
***

Группа: Участник*
Сообщений: 418
Регистрация: 20-08-07
Пользователь №: 29 930



Цитата(rv3dll(lex) @ Jan 14 2008, 16:33) *
а через год не будет карточек под фат 16
а именно останутся 4 8 16 и 32 гб

А через 5-ть практически наверняка еще Windows-XP станет раритетом - ну так и что c того? biggrin.gif biggrin.gif biggrin.gif
А так же очень возможный вариант - исчезновение архитектуры Pentium, на которой товарищ собирается обработкой записанного заниматься...


Вообще - каждый из нас однажды исчезнет с лица земли - но это же не основание ничего не делать в связи с этим.
Go to the top of the page
 
+Quote Post
TBI
сообщение Jan 14 2008, 13:57
Сообщение #33


Частый гость
**

Группа: Свой
Сообщений: 170
Регистрация: 11-05-07
Пользователь №: 27 656



Насколько я понял, то устройство <i>MMos</i> не для обычного потребителя, а для своих целей. Ну тогда можно приобрести требуемое количество карточек и пользоваться. Тем более, что их стоимость (до 2 Gbytes) не так уж велика.
Go to the top of the page
 
+Quote Post
MMos
сообщение Jan 16 2008, 07:48
Сообщение #34


Частый гость
**

Группа: Участник
Сообщений: 147
Регистрация: 7-12-07
Пользователь №: 33 057



Почитал спецификации USB. Хорошо излагают, собаки! Идея хорошая и обдуманная и проработанная. И, бесспорно, реализуемая. Но как для моих целей сложновата. Мне нужно всего лишь технологическое устройство с небольшим сроком жизни. Тратить пол-года на разработку не хочется. Покупать чужое и пол-года разбираться, почему оно работает не так, как мне надо тоже не хочется.
Где-бы почитать про MMC, SD, SPI, чтобы попонятнее?
Конечyо можно сказать - Ищи сам, написано много. Действительно много, но 99,9% из того, что написано, лучше не читать. Если кто-то прошёл по пути, на котором я сейчас нахожусь, и достиг положительного результата - поделитесь.
Go to the top of the page
 
+Quote Post
zltigo
сообщение Jan 16 2008, 08:09
Сообщение #35


Гуру
******

Группа: Свой
Сообщений: 13 372
Регистрация: 27-11-04
Из: Riga, Latvia
Пользователь №: 1 244



Цитата(TBI @ Jan 14 2008, 16:57) *
Ну тогда можно приобрести требуемое количество карточек и пользоваться.

1. Не вижу никаих причин не поддерживать и FAT32
2. Никто не запрещает форматироват и использовать карточку на часть емкости.
3. Использовние USB брелков не отменяет наличия файловой системы.

Цитата(MMos @ Jan 16 2008, 10:48) *
Ищи сам, написано много. Действительно много, но 99,9% из того, что написано, лучше не читать.

Ну это явное преувеличение в среднем около 90%. В интересных вещах общего назначения, типа файловых систем, стеков IP, операционных систем,.....того, чего стоит читать - заметно больше.
Цитата
Если кто-то прошёл по пути, на котором я сейчас нахожусь, и достиг положительного результата - поделитесь.

Если кто-то решил результаты своего труда выложить, но скорее всего он уже выложил и без Вашего призыва. Посему действительно приникать к первоисточникам, читать написанное другими толкователями первоисточников( при этом критически оценивая чужой труд), делать свое и.... принимать решение делиться или нет smile.gif


--------------------
Feci, quod potui, faciant meliora potentes
Go to the top of the page
 
+Quote Post
Николай Z
сообщение Jan 16 2008, 08:31
Сообщение #36


Местный
***

Группа: Участник*
Сообщений: 418
Регистрация: 20-08-07
Пользователь №: 29 930



Цитата(MMos @ Jan 16 2008, 10:48) *
Почитал спецификации USB. Хорошо излагают, собаки! Идея хорошая и обдуманная и проработанная. И, бесспорно, реализуемая. Но как для моих целей сложновата.
Значит Вам нужен не USB, а что-то попроще - ну например вывод Ваших данных в UART, а далее - запись их в файл на ноутбуке к примеру или что-то аналогичное с простым интерфейсом с записью в КПК...

Цитата(MMos @ Jan 16 2008, 10:48) *
.... но 99,9% из того, что написано, лучше не читать. Если кто-то прошёл по пути, на котором я сейчас нахожусь, и достиг положительного результата - поделитесь.
Странный вывод для меня... Мои оценки совершенно другие - как минимум 60% из опубликованного может быть применено с большой эффективностью, но собственный труд и довольно большой - всегда будет нужен.

Сообщение отредактировал Николай Z - Jan 16 2008, 08:33
Go to the top of the page
 
+Quote Post
one_man_show
сообщение Jan 16 2008, 16:04
Сообщение #37


Помогу, чем смогу
******

Группа: Админы
Сообщений: 2 786
Регистрация: 28-05-04
Из: Москва
Пользователь №: 25



Может автору стоит выбрать следующий путь, раз времени в обрез и возможности/желания нет изучать глубину вопросв: по одному из известных производителей МК с USB (например, у SiLabs готовое решение с исходниками USB Mass Storage Reference Design ) приобретается кит (или изготавливается макет самостоятельно), скачивается софт для кита, проводится тестирование для получения минимальных знаний о происходящем, далее флаг в руки, то есть copy-paste из примеров в свой проект. Такой подход позволяет реализовать неизвестный фрагмент-интерфейс-протокол... в течение недели (со временем приобретения кита).


--------------------
С уважением,
Ваган Саруханов
Проекты|Форум|Facebook|Linkedin
Go to the top of the page
 
+Quote Post
Николай Z
сообщение Jan 17 2008, 10:53
Сообщение #38


Местный
***

Группа: Участник*
Сообщений: 418
Регистрация: 20-08-07
Пользователь №: 29 930



Цитата(one_man_show @ Jan 16 2008, 19:04) *
Такой подход позволяет реализовать неизвестный фрагмент-интерфейс-протокол... в течение недели (со временем приобретения кита).

Протокол работы с USB-flash-кой за неделю не реализуется никакими путями ни на каких чипах. Даже при наличии референсе-дизайна.
Товарищу надо с необходимостью от флэшки отказываться. Там как пространство не квантуй - все одно надо или формировать файл в файловой системе или научить PC - читать нестандартно(без файловой системы) - читать информацию с флэшки... Но даже поблочный обмен это достьаточно сложный прокол взаимодействия, на который все-таки уйдет намного больше времени, чем неделя - даже при условии, что он будет присутствовать в готовом виде в каком-нибудь референсе-дизайне.

Сообщение отредактировал Николай Z - Jan 17 2008, 10:57
Go to the top of the page
 
+Quote Post
one_man_show
сообщение Jan 17 2008, 12:13
Сообщение #39


Помогу, чем смогу
******

Группа: Админы
Сообщений: 2 786
Регистрация: 28-05-04
Из: Москва
Пользователь №: 25



Я привел пример, основанный на очень конкретном опыте: поручил задачу аспиранту, который хорошо знает МК, но первый раз работает с USB Mass Storage Device. Требовалось в существующий проект добавить функционал USB-флэшки, что он и сделал меньше, чем за неделю, воспользовавшись указанным референс-дизайном, то есть добавил в аппаратную часть необходимые доп.компоненты, а в исходники проекта добавил нужные куски из исходников реф.дизайна. В результате в проекте появилась поддержка файловой системы и доп. режим USB MSD, когда железка подключена к компьютеру


--------------------
С уважением,
Ваган Саруханов
Проекты|Форум|Facebook|Linkedin
Go to the top of the page
 
+Quote Post
Николай Z
сообщение Jan 17 2008, 12:29
Сообщение #40


Местный
***

Группа: Участник*
Сообщений: 418
Регистрация: 20-08-07
Пользователь №: 29 930



Цитата(one_man_show @ Jan 17 2008, 15:13) *
Я привел пример, основанный на очень конкретном опыте: поручил задачу аспиранту, который хорошо знает МК, но первый раз работает с USB Mass Storage Device. Требовалось в существующий проект добавить функционал USB-флэшки, что он и сделал меньше, чем за неделю, воспользовавшись указанным референс-дизайном, то есть добавил в аппаратную часть необходимые доп.компоненты, а в исходники проекта добавил нужные куски из исходников реф.дизайна. В результате в проекте появилась поддержка файловой системы и доп. режим USB MSD, когда железка подключена к компьютеру

Ну может быть... Вообще-то у меня не один проект был связан с USB...
И все до рабочего - пригодного к тиражированию вида доводились по 2-4 месяца - невзирая на наличие референс дизайнов.
Конечно сляпать как-нибудь - лишь бы дышало - нетрудно и можно и за 2-4 дня вполне... (пример - отечественный РУ-токен который использует 10% от пропускной способности Full-speed), но я такой вариант даже не рассматриваю.

В любом случае для вопрошаюшего товарища - планировать 1-2 недели на это дело было бы фантастикой... Мы уже тут неделю ему только ответы пишем. ;-)

Сообщение отредактировал Николай Z - Jan 17 2008, 12:32
Go to the top of the page
 
+Quote Post
one_man_show
сообщение Jan 17 2008, 13:09
Сообщение #41


Помогу, чем смогу
******

Группа: Админы
Сообщений: 2 786
Регистрация: 28-05-04
Из: Москва
Пользователь №: 25



По поводу сроков полностью с Вами согласен Николай Z smile.gif


--------------------
С уважением,
Ваган Саруханов
Проекты|Форум|Facebook|Linkedin
Go to the top of the page
 
+Quote Post

3 страниц V  < 1 2 3
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 27th August 2025 - 21:07
Рейтинг@Mail.ru


Страница сгенерированна за 0.01357 секунд с 7
ELECTRONIX ©2004-2016